新注册GitHub账号无法下载源码的解决方案

在使用GitHub进行代码管理和下载的过程中,许多新用户可能会遇到一个常见问题:新注册的GitHub账号无法下载源码。这不仅会影响开发工作,还会让人感到困惑和沮丧。本文将详细探讨此问题的原因及解决方法,帮助用户顺利下载所需源码。

一、为何新注册的GitHub账号无法下载源码?

新用户在GitHub上下载源码时遇到问题,可能与以下几个方面有关:

1. GitHub账户验证

  • GitHub要求用户通过邮箱验证才能享受全部功能。
  • 未验证邮箱的用户可能会受到限制,导致无法下载源码。

2. 权限设置

  • 某些私有库或特定项目可能设置了权限,限制了下载。
  • 作为新用户,如果未获得相应的访问权限,将无法下载特定的源码。

3. 网络问题

  • 有时,网络连接问题也会导致下载失败。
  • 防火墙或安全软件可能会阻止下载请求。

4. 操作流程不当

  • 新用户在操作时可能没有遵循正确的下载步骤。
  • 对Git和GitHub的理解不足可能会导致下载失败。

二、解决新注册GitHub账号无法下载源码的方法

针对上述原因,我们可以采取以下解决措施:

1. 完成邮箱验证

  • 登陆你的GitHub账号。
  • 检查你的邮箱,查找GitHub发送的验证邮件,并按照邮件中的指引完成验证。
  • 验证完成后,重新尝试下载源码。

2. 请求访问权限

  • 如果你想下载私有库的源码,需联系库的所有者请求访问权限。
  • 确认是否已经获得了该库的协作权限。

3. 检查网络连接

  • 确保网络连接正常,尝试访问其他网站确认是否存在网络问题。
  • 如果使用VPN,建议暂时关闭,重新尝试下载。

4. 了解正确的下载步骤

  • 使用Git命令下载源码:
    • 克隆库:git clone <repository-url>
    • 直接下载ZIP文件:在项目页面点击“Code”按钮,然后选择“Download ZIP”。

三、如何有效使用GitHub下载源码?

使用GitHub下载源码的步骤相对简单,但仍需注意以下几点:

1. 学习基本Git命令

  • 对于常用的下载命令,如克隆(clone)、获取(fetch)、拉取(pull),用户应有所了解。
  • 了解这些命令可以有效避免操作失误。

2. 利用GitHub的网页界面

  • 许多用户可能不知道,GitHub提供了网页下载选项,用户可以直接从项目页面下载ZIP文件。
  • 该方式适合不熟悉Git命令的用户。

3. 保持更新

  • 定期更新GitHub客户端和本地Git版本,确保能够顺利与GitHub进行交互。

四、常见问题解答(FAQ)

1. 新账号在GitHub上下载源码是否需要付费?

新注册的GitHub账号在下载公共项目的源码时是免费的,私有库则需要相应的权限或付费。

2. 如果下载的源码存在错误,应该怎么办?

首先确认你下载的是最新版本。如果仍有问题,可以查看项目的“issues”部分,寻找已知问题的解决方案,或直接联系维护者。

3. 为什么我无法下载特定的私有库?

只有获得该私有库的访问权限后,才能进行下载。确保已向库的所有者请求并获得相应的权限。

4. 新账号需要多久才能使用所有功能?

通常,在完成邮箱验证后,新账号就可以使用GitHub的绝大多数功能。如果遇到问题,可以查看GitHub的帮助中心或联系客服。

5. 有没有工具可以帮助我下载GitHub上的源码?

是的,有许多工具和插件可以简化GitHub上的源码下载过程,如GitHub Desktop和其他Git GUI工具。

总结

新注册的GitHub账号在下载源码时遇到问题,常常是由于邮箱未验证、权限设置、网络问题或操作不当等原因。通过本文提供的方法,相信新用户可以有效解决这些问题,顺利下载所需的源码。希望您在GitHub的使用中能够更加顺畅,享受开源带来的乐趣。

正文完